LUIS FLORES NAMED MAAC PLAYER OF THE YEAR

Albany, NY (March 5, 2004)- Manhattan College senior Luis Flores was named MAAC Player of the Year, it was announced today at the MAAC Awards Banquet at the Pepsi Arena, the site of the HSBC MAAC Basketball Championships. This is the second consecutive year that Flores has received this award from the MAAC, in voting done by the conference's head coaches.

Flores, who was named to the All-MAAC First Team for the third straight year earlier this week, adds Player of the Year honors to an already impressive resume. He averaged 24.1 points and 3.9 rebounds a game for the Jaspers during the regular season. This season he moved into second place on the Manhattan all-time scoring list as well as the MAAC all-time scoring list for conference games. Flores becomes just the third student-athlete to be named MAAC Men's Basketball Player of the Year two straight years, and the first since LaSalle's Lionel Simmons won the award three straight years from 1988-1990. Iona's Steve Burtt won the award after the 1982-83 and 1983-84 seasons.

Manhattan posted a 22-5 record, 16-2 in MAAC play during the regular season, and is the #1 seed in the MAAC Tournament. The Jaspers receive a double-bye to the semifinals, played on Sunday, March 7 at 7:30 p.m. The 16 MAAC wins is the most by a MAAC team since the conference expanded to an 18 game conference slate, and ties LaSalle for the most ever conference wins.
